Rochester Mayo (28-2), which got 29 points from Amelia Mills and 22 from Maggie Dyer, played its third straight game decided by one possession. The Spartans won both their section final over Lakeville North and state quarterfinal over Monticello by two points.
The “Game of the Year” is here: Menchville (25-1) versus Princess Anne (27-0) for the Class 5 girls basketball state championship at 6 p.m. Thursday at Virginia Commonwealth University’s Siegel Center in Richmond.
